HOUSTON, Texas - Quality Companies, the global offshore and onshore construction, fabrication and electrical and instrumentation company, has appointed Wayne Lacey as vice president of operations for Zadok Technologies.

Based in Houston, Lacey will be responsible for supervising and managing the sustainability and profitability of all of Zadok Technologies’ operational procedures.

BJERRINGBRO, Denmark - In celebration of Grundfos' 75th anniversary, the Poul Due Jensen Foundation (Grundfos Foundation) has expanded its budget for donations from planned 125m DKK (Danish krone) to 200m DKK. The main donation areas remain water, research, and inclusion, but the Foundation will move its attention to the fight against COVID-19 this year.
